Do Animals Experience Sadness?

What emotions do animals experience? Many believe animals feel a range of emotions, including sadness.

Animals share similar emotional responses to humans. For instance, dogs display sadness after losing a companion. You might observe them becoming lethargic, withdrawing from social interactions, or refusing food. These behaviors signify an emotional response to loss.

Elephants also exhibit mourning behaviors. They form close social bonds and show signs of sorrow when a member of their herd dies. They often gather around the deceased, touching and caressing the body. This suggests a deep emotional connection and collective grief.

Primates, our closest relatives, also show sadness. Chimpanzees can become visibly upset, exhibiting behaviors like slumping or whimpering when separated from their social group or loved ones.

Numerous scientific studies support the idea that animals can feel sadness. Researchers observe animals in natural habitats or controlled settings, monitoring for signs such as decreased activity, loss of appetite, or changes in sleep patterns.

Recognizing sadness in animals is important. Their complex emotional lives deserve our acknowledgment and respect. Ensuring their well-being contributes to their happiness.
